I was nervous driving up the road and seeing only small pull offs but we kept going & found a great open space for ourselves & new caravan companion! Well kept, some trash around which was sad. I ended up driving to the ranger station to buy a parks pass & they were so sweet, asking how it was up here & if they needed to come take care of anything. We stayed for 3 nights under the beautiful pine trees & had lots of space to explore with our dogs. Super quiet, great spot.

Stayed here two nights in a great pullthrough spot right next to the main entrance road and just feet from the main trailhead. It was the start of duck hunting season so it was a tad busy. Overall the spots are pretty clean, we had a nice fire ring at out spot, our site was firm and level and although we didn't use it, the bathroom area was nice. Entry to the area was gravel road, not too dumpy, and everyone we talked to was very friendly. Some family made a bit of noise in the early evening, typical kid stuff, but they quieted down long before bed time. On day two we were enjoying a quiet morning, late start, when we heard what we thought was gunfire very close to camp. I assumed it was duckhunters, and it was close enough to get my adrenaline going. But.. It turns out it was actually a large old tree that snapped and fell right across the main entry road, only about 300 yards from our camp. My GF and I pulled the branches out of the road so we could exit without using the shoulder, since we were pulling a large cargo trailer. So be mindful of sleeping under any dead trees if you are tent camping! Overall a pleasant two day, two night stay that I would visit again. The town of Alto about 7 miles away has decent grocery stores. But aside from hiking and hunting there isn't a ton to do right around there.
